Slept in some so just ran on the treadmill.  Ankle acted up a few times.  But wasnt to bad.  Wanted to get in at least 10 and made it to 13.  First 2 miles were at a 8:36 pace then up it to 8:00 for the rest of the run.  Ankle was quite sore at the end of the night.  So iced it and going to be better about icing it.  Did get enough time after my run to ice it.  Went out and tried to get some of the snow removed before my parents came home.
